Output 2505492d02a93fc177c5de2a9bd23e76b242e001e6c1d5b2e439d6bfcac21e6d:0

value
2140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d46bf4fddb8c137059358ad7d8f2815659a07432 OP_EQUAL
address
3M4CWCJ8VnbqvNBW4Hcqi7CSQbhCStBtF9
transaction
2505492d02a93fc177c5de2a9bd23e76b242e001e6c1d5b2e439d6bfcac21e6d